  • Patent number: 11974469
    Abstract: Disclosed is a display device and a method of manufacturing the same having improved reliability. In the display device, at least one of a plurality of dielectric films disposed between an oxide semiconductor layer and a light-emitting device includes a lower region disposed on the oxide semiconductor layer and an upper region disposed on the lower region, the upper region including a trap element configured to trap hydrogen, whereby reliability of a thin film transistor including the oxide semiconductor layer is improved.

  • Patent number: 10636888
    Abstract: A thin film transistor includes a gate electrode on a substrate. The gate electrode includes a flat portion and an inclined portion at a side of the flat portion. A ratio of a height to a width (height/width) of the inclined portion is 1.192 or less. The thin film transistor also includes a gate insulating layer disposed on the substrate to cover the gate electrode and a polysilicon active layer on the gate insulating layer and over the gate electrode. The thin film transistor further includes a source electrode and a drain electrode respectively connected to two opposite end portions of the polysilicon active layer.

  • Patent number: 7151404
    Abstract: A pulse width modulation (PWM) circuit comprising an input circuit, first and second controllers, and first and second Schmidt triggers. The first controller sets a first voltage level by a first current generated responding to an input signal and an output of the input circuit. The first Schmidt trigger sets a first logic level when an output of the first controller reaches the first voltage level. The second controller sets a second voltage level by a second current generated responding to the input signal and an output of the first Schmidt trigger. The second Schmidt trigger generates a PWM output signal with a variable frequency in accordance with the first and second currents.

  • Publication number: 20060100726
    Abstract: A digital audio amplifier, an audio system including the same and a method of amplifying an audio signal that can reduce switching noise interference generated in a pulse width modulator are provided. The digital audio amplifier includes a selection circuit, a digital signal processor and a pulse width modulator. The selection circuit selects one of an audio data signal and a digitized broadcasting signal to output a digital input signal. The digital signal processor samples the digital input signal using one of a plurality of oversampling frequencies based on a local oscillator output signal and a separation signal to output a sampled digital signal. The pulse width modulator performs a pulse width modulation on the sampled digital signal.
